  Paper Title

A Comparative Clinical Study To Assess The Effect Of Matra Basti With Masha Taila And Ksheerabala Taila 7 Aavarthita In Mannagement Of Kampavata With Special Refrence To Parkinson's Disease

  Authors

  Dr P N Nagaraj,  DR V S KANTHI

  Keywords

Kampavata, Parkinson's Disease, Matra Basti, Ksheerabala Taila, Masha Taila

  Abstract


Kampavata is one of the vatavyadhi, Basavarajeeyam gives a brief description of this with symptoms such as Kara pada tala kampa, Deha brahmana, Nidrabhanga, Matiksheena, etc. Kampavata can be correlated to Parkinson's disease. It is a neurodegenerative disease. It is a progressive loss of structure or functions of neurons including the death of neurons ranging from molecular to the systemic level. Tremor, rigidity, and bradykinesia are the main symptoms of Parkinson's disease; these symptoms are similar to Kampa, Sanga, and Gatisanga. These are mainly because of Vata. Here Vata Dosha is responsible for the disease which is originating either in Sakha, Koshta, Marma, Asthi, or Sandhi. A mixture of Saindhava and Madhu generates the hydroelectric energies in nerve cells for communication. Due to the Sukshma property of Sneha, it helps the drug to reach the microcellular level. The medicinal value of Kalka and Kwatha helps with curative, purification, and preventive aspects. Basti acts as a regenerative process. Its Veerya helps to disrupt the pathogenic process and carries out the morbid matter towards Pakvashaya for elimination, there after by absorption it starts its regenerative process. The clinical trial was undertaken to compare the efficacy of Matra Basti with Masha Taila and Ksheerabala Taila 7 aavarthita in the management of Kampavata (Parkinson's Disease). 30 patients having classical symptom of Kampavata of either sex were selected and divided into two groups; consisting of 15 patients in each group. In Group-A Matra Basti was administered with Masha Taila in dose of 60ml was inserted through rectum for 9 consecutive days. In Group-B Matra Basti was administered with Ksheerabalataila 7 aavarthita in dose of 60ml was inserted through rectum for 9 consecutive days. The clinical assessment was done using Modified Universal Parkinson's Disease Rating Scale. All symptoms were given scoring depending upon their severity from 0 to 4. The results were subjected to Wilcoxon signed rank test and Mann Whitney U Test Rank it suggests no significant difference after the treatment. Overall the results are not much better in both groups. So far, the experience with treatment has been good and the response is up to 25% in all the patients of both groups.
